This thought-provoking book, first published in 1991, examines
sexual politics in a world which is being radically changed by the
challenges of feminism. Seidler explores how men have responded to
feminism, and the contradictory feelings men have towards dominant
forms of masculinity. Seidler's stimulating and original analysis
of social and political theory connects personally to everyday
issues in people's lives. It reflects the growing importance of
sexual and personal politics within contemporary politics and
culture, and demonstrates clearly the challenge that feminism
brings to our inherited forms of morality, politics and sexuality.
